M1 1-1 St Neots Mens 2

South were looking for three points at home to St Neots but once again were thwarted in their efforts. Fielding a strong side for a change, skipper Graveling was confident he could lead his team to victory but early in the first half an unfortunate incident scuppered that plan.

A clash between two players was followed by an unnecessary off-the-ball reaction by a South player. Both were yellow carded. The St Neots player was let back on the pitch after ten minutes of the second half but the South player was off for the remainder of the game.

With only ten men each, the game opened up and some excellent hockey was played by South who dominated possession and territory. A breakaway goal against the run of play from St Neots wasn't pretty as the ball dribbled over the line after a goalmouth scramble. South replied in much more emphatic fashion after the restart. The ball was fired into the D from a free hit and Fleck expertly turned it into the net. A textbook goal which secured a well deserved point.

The return match will be interesting…
